Rooftop fencing must be wind-resistant above all else.

Rooftops face stronger and more unpredictable winds than ground-level areas. According to the American Society of Civil Engineers, wind pressure increases with height, making rooftops particularly vulnerable. A standard residential fence wouldn’t survive on a rooftop and trying to install one could put lives at risk.

That’s why every rooftop fence must be engineered with structural integrity as the top priority. At SLEEKFENCE, we use structural-grade aluminum, stronger and lighter than steel, and every system we install on rooftops is custom reinforced to meet site-specific wind load calculations. Our fence panels are also vented to reduce wind resistance, allowing air to pass through while maintaining privacy and style.

What makes SLEEKFENCE the best rooftop fencing system?

Most fences weren’t designed to live on rooftops. But ours are. SLEEKFENCE panels are fabricated from powder-coated 6063-T6 aluminum, used in everything from skyscraper curtain walls to high-performance aircraft. That means they won’t rust, warp, or corrode, even in extreme weather.

Plus, SLEEKFENCE is modular and ultra-lightweight, making it easier and safer to install in rooftop environments where crane lifts, limited access, and structural load restrictions all come into play. We also offer mounting options tailored to your rooftop’s structure, whether you’re bolting into concrete, anchoring to steel, or working with waterproof membranes.
